Get a grip on guns

After the multiple tragedies due to lack of gun control that I have experienced not only on television but in real life, I know it is time to get a grip on our weapons, and on our nation. Many believe that distributing more guns will increase our safety. I find this idea ludicrous.

Shootings, such as those in Connecticut and Colorado, have been allowed because of irresponsible control of firearms. Adam Lanza literally stole his mother’s gun, proving to the public that it was kept in an easy access area when weapons of that power should be held responsibly.

Events like this clearly prove to this nation that we need to step up on gun control.
